Address NGkmyMSfRm2nifsS6JSHV17BFt1izuXU6E

Total received 22.52533131 NMC
Total sent 22.52533131 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 29, 2022, 9:18 p.m. ed4b91048… 609874 22.52533131 NMC 0.00000000 NMC
April 29, 2022, 9:18 p.m. e06afcf21… 609874 22.52533131 NMC 0.00000000 NMC